Transaction 42451b66e54463ce3fc3fd65052752507d00a3eab5dafc664f36aedf36adda17

2 Input
2 Outputs
  • 42451b66e54463ce3fc3fd65052752507d00a3eab5dafc664f36aedf36adda17:0
  • value  1367726
    address  3Jf12MrqdKKGtSP33y5k3HUmXbPX8kkrf7
  • 42451b66e54463ce3fc3fd65052752507d00a3eab5dafc664f36aedf36adda17:1
  • value  2671410
    address  122a9cGG4RtWYq819pUs2picUKoy5waeNY